  6. Discussion thread: RUSTIC SOULGEMS by Gamwich and Saerileth Wiki Link RUSTIC SOULGEMS features hi-res textures and modified meshes. The soulgems now have transparency and a subtle animated color-shifting effect. Each soulgem has it's own diffuse texture, rather than sharing textures as in the default version. Normal maps are still shared to keep the file size down. The soulgem holder has been retextured as well. 2K and 1K versions are available.   11. True Storms - Thunder and Rain Redone This might be a revolution. DESCRIPTION Fixes the vanilla "thunder loop" problem! (see below)Adds 20 new thunder sounds and new method for TRUE unpredictable/random playbackAdds 3 new ambient rain sounds of varying intensityAdds all-new rain textures, and new rain/snow particle effects for heavy density and realismOptional plugin for vanilla weather with dark nightsOptional plugin for diverse weathers (spreads all weathers across all regions)Compatible with vanilla, Pure Weather, Natural Lighting and Atmospherics (CoT on the way)!THIS MOD IS 100% SCRIPT-FREE AND COMPLETELY SAFE TO ADD/REMOVE AT ANY TIME.The vanilla game has an annoying problem where upon loading a rainy weather, it will select a single thunder sound from the available group, and continue to play that ONE sound only until the weather changes. A number of people have suffered from this "thunder loop" problem, and I decided to do something about it. I did extensive testing and found a workaround that allows TRUE random playback of thunder. No scripts or other trickery involved! This mod improved the 8 vanilla sounds, then adds 20 all-new, intense, high quality thunder sounds to the game, all which will trigger at random. Sometimes over top of each other. Sometimes it will stay quiet for a minute or two, sometimes it will RAGE. It's completely unpredictable! STORMS NOW FEEL SCARY, AND EXTREMELY IMMERSIVE!   21. Does your graphic card have 1GB of VRAM or something? The resolution of textures is absolutely irrelevant to framerate unless you overfill the card's memory with too many high resolution textures, at which point you might experience some stuttering. At this time and age I can't imagine a single mod consisting of 2k textures do that unless it's installed on prehistoric PC.
